Oligomeric HALS offer a distinct advantage over their monomeric counterparts primarily due to their higher molecular weight. This structural characteristic translates into significantly improved resistance to migration and extraction. For applications where the polymer might come into contact with solvents, water, or undergo abrasive processes, this low migration property is invaluable. It ensures that the light stabilizing capabilities are retained within the polymer matrix for extended periods, providing consistent and reliable protection against UV degradation. This benefit is particularly important for manufacturers aiming to meet stringent performance standards and customer expectations for durability. Furthermore, the compatibility of these oligomeric HALS with a wide array of polymer systems is a key attribute. They readily integrate into polyolefins, including polyethylene (PE) and polypropylene (PP), as well as into more complex formulations like EVA copolymers and PVC blends. This broad compatibility simplifies the formulation process for plastic compounders and manufacturers, reducing the need for specialized processing adjustments. The ability to achieve excellent light and thermal stability across diverse polymer types makes them a versatile choice for a broad spectrum of applications, from automotive components to agricultural films and consumer goods. The regenerative mechanism inherent to HALS also contributes to their cost-effectiveness. They are not consumed in the process of stabilizing the polymer but are continuously regenerated, meaning a smaller concentration can provide long-lasting protection. This efficiency, combined with their inherent durability, makes them a wise investment for manufacturers aiming to reduce material costs while enhancing product quality.
